The Cards already have committed $19 million to QB Kevin Kolb, including his $7 million offseason roster bonus, but coach Ken Whisenhunt said that won't factor in the QB competition with John Skelton. "I obviously know how much we invested in Kevin. I want Kevin to be successful. I want him to be our quarterback, but I'm not going to ignore the fact that John Skelton worked pretty hard and did a pretty good job when he was in there," Whisenhunt said. "He's earned the right to compete for that spot."
